Tips for Getting the Most Out of your Walker Turner Drill Press

To maximize the performance and longevity of your Walker Turner drill press, consider the following tips:

1. Proper Maintenance

Regularly clean and lubricate your drill press to prevent dust and debris build-up and ensure smooth operation. Additionally, periodically check for any loose screws or parts that may affect performance.

2. Use the Right Bits and Accessories

Using the correct drill bits and accessories for your specific drilling needs can significantly improve your results. Match the bit size and type to the material you are drilling into, and consider using auxiliary clamps or fences for added stability.

3. Follow Safety Guidelines

Always wear appropriate safety gear, such as safety glasses and ear protection, when operating a drill press. Familiarize yourself with the drill press’s safety features and follow proper operating procedures to minimize the risk of accidents.
